Nate Williams wrote: > > > Perhaps pccard_alloc_intr should start from the higher interrupts and work > > > down the list. > > See the CVS logs. :) > > > I did that change and it worked. Perhaps it would even be better > > to be able to configure the irq the pcic will be using. > > This is the best solution, but there's no easy solution to implementing > it. If you can come up with one I'm all ears/eyes. It would not be that hard. Modify config to come up with something in ioconf.c. Let's call it card_devtab with something like: id, irq, flags when irq is 0, alloacte one. When it is set, use it. The flags field is for whatever usage. -Guido
